Ferretti 560
Ferretti Yachts introduces Ferretti 560, a model which represents the yacht (r)evolution conceived to enable owners to experience a new feeling of life on board. Through this new model, the shipyard aims to consolidate and continue the evolution process of the flybridge range under 63 feet. Over the past two years, this renewal has involved the launch of new yachts which have become icons of innovation in design, such as Ferretti 470, Ferretti 510 and Ferretti 592.

Result of the working relationship between Ferretti Group’s Advanced Yacht Technology and Studio Zuccon International Project, Ferretti 560 embodies all the shipyards precious elements of design tradition with a new evolution which could be identified in three key-elements: innovative space-design of the lower deck layout; painstaking care over detail featured in contemporary style décor elements; and a new, exclusive, window design to enhance natural light on board. As a result, Ferretti 560 is a unique yacht in her category, created to meet the demands of clients of any age, and offering the highest standards of liveability through a combination of wide spaces, high quality materials, comfort and performance.

The position of the galley at stern makes it possible to create an all-in-one open space connecting cockpit-galley and salon in order to optimize liveability.

Great attention has been paid to the area below deck: the master cabin has been positioned in the centre of the yacht, covering the total width of the hull, and is lit by two large open-view windows. The master head has a separate shower and large window and portholes that can be opened. For the other guests on board, Ferretti 560 offers a double cabin in the bow with head, and a twin cabin with a dual-access head.

Ferretti 560 has been conceived with a contemporary design&decor style. Painstaking care has been taken over detail, maintaining a perfect balance between the functionality and style research of the materials to achieve a highly elegant result.
The bleached oak wood enhances the brightness of the spaces featuring refined colour contrasts created by the warm tones of the details in wood or leather, such as the ceiling coverings, bed-perimeter, curtain-case or headboard decorations that mix lights and materials.
Ferretti 560 features twin MAN V8-900 engines which drive the yacht to a cruise speed of 28 knots and a top speed of 32.
